Abstract

This journal examines the social life of the Sangtam community, one of the major tribes of Nagaland. It explores the traditional institutions, customs, and cultural practices that have shaped sangtam society over generations. The study discusses important aspects of village life, family structure, social organization, marriage customs, naming ceremonies, and village administration. It also highlights the significance of the Morung and Women’s dormitory as centres of social learning and cultural transmission. In addition, the journal examines the festivals, religious beliefs, and rituals that reflect the spiritual and cultural identity of the Sangtam people. The study emphasizes how these institutions and practices contributed to social cohesion, governance, and the preservation of cultural heritage. While modernization, education and Christianity have brought significant changes to many traditional customs, the Sangtam community continues to preserve important elements of its cultural identity.
